Adrianne Curry
Adrianne Marie Curry Rhode was born on August 6, 1982. Her most famous work is the winner of the first season of America's Next Top Model in 2003. Curry was America's Next Top Model in the first season. She was signed to Wilhelmina Models in New York City. She has been a model for various magazines such as Life & Style, Us Weekly, Star, OK!, Stuff, People, Maxim (and made the Maxim Hot 100 list in 2005), Spanish Marie Claire, Von Dutch, Von Dutch Watches, Salon City, Macy's, Famous Stars and Straps, Lucky, Ed Hardy, Kinis Bikinis, Beverly Hills Choppers, and Merit Diamonds. Anne Bowen, Jaime Pressly's line, Ed Hardy and Von Dutch were among the runway shows of Curry. Christopher Deane was also present. Curry was featured in a commercial for Merit Diamonds Sirena Collection that was on display from November 2004 until January 2006. She was on the cover and in a photo of a naked woman for the American edition of Playboy in February of 2006. Curry was back for a second cover and a nude photoshoot for the January 2008 issue. Curry was named one of Playboy's top 25 most sexually attractive females in 2008, as well as the 100 most popular Playboy spreads for 2008. In late 2006, Curry did a modeling for a tech demo created by Nvidia to showcase their video cards. She was a spokesmodel for "The Flex Belt" together with Lisa Rinna and Denise Richards.
